Position: School Nurse
 
Location: Lagos
 
General Responsibilities
Manage and coordinate the assigned school's health services program based on school division policies, procedures, and protocols, and by local, state and national regulations and statues; maintain and operate the school clinic.
 
Essential Tasks
* Ensure compliance with procedures, protocols, and other instructions provided by the coordinator of health services or contained in division manuals and protocols.
* Provide nursing care and physical screening to students; assess students and implement first aid measures for students as needed.
* Assume responsibility for appropriate assessment, planning, intervention, evaluation, management, and referral activities for students.
* Initiate emergency procedures for students and staff as needed.
* Maintain clinic equipment and assesses the need for consumable supplies on an annual basis.
 
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
* Ability to use clinic/medical equipment; possess basic pharmacological knowledge; ability to assess emergency situations and act accordingly;
* Comfortable knowledge of universal procedures and ability to teach this to others;
* Good oral and written communication skills;
 
Basic computer skills;
* Willing attitude to be a part of the school team;
* Strong sense of professionalism;
* Management and organizational ability, common sense, motivation, positive attitude;
* And the ability/willingness to participate in ongoing professional and staff development, both independently and through system-offered opportunities.
 
Education and Experience
* Graduate from an accredited nursing program; Bachelor of Nursing Degree preferred; licensed as a registered nurse.
* A minimum of three to four years nursing experience and experience in community health, pediatrics, emergency care.
